Marlin 1897 Bicycle Rifle

Filed under: History, USA, Weapons — Tags: , , , , — Nicholas @ 02:00

Forgotten Weapons
Published 23 Feb 2016

Marlin’s 1892 lever action rifle in .22 rimfire caliber proved to be a very popular firearm, and so the company released an improved version in 1897, offered only as a rimfire takedown model. The 1897 would also prove very popular, and the same basic design would continue later as the Model 39.

One interesting variant of the 1897 offered was a Bicycle Rifle. While the rifle was generally available only with fairly long barrels, the bicycle version had a 16″ barrel and full-length magazine tube. This was sized specifically to fit in a special case (disassembled) underneath the top bar of a bicycle frame, allowing kids to easily use their bicycles to take these rifles to their favorite shooting spots.

While the 1897 itself was popular, the bicycle variant was not, with Marlin sales records showing only 197 sold.

Galand de Guerre Model 1872: Too Good for the Military

Filed under: France, History, Military, Weapons — Tags: , , , — Nicholas @ 02:00

Forgotten Weapons
Published 23 Jun 2025

Charles François Galand is best known for his simultaneous-extraction Model 1868, but he also developed a very good solid-frame revolver. This was specifically for the French 1871 military trials, which specifically required a solid frame. The Galand was chambered for 12mm Galand (with its distinctive very thick rim), held 6 rounds, operated in either single or double action, required no tools to disassemble, and had very simple but durable lockwork. The gun was very good, and was a very tight competitor for the other trials finalist, the Chamelot-Delvigne. Ultimately, it lost out because it was the more expensive of the two options.

A minor gaming distraction

Filed under: Gaming — Tags: , — Nicholas @ 03:00

On the social media site formerly known as Twitter, Matt Gurney takes a few minutes while waiting for the impending catastrophe of the federal budget to be released to talk about a game I’m quite familiar with (and generally share his opinions on):

It’s budget day. My job is only going to get busy in the afternoon and evening. So now is a good time to inflict a non-news and non-political tweet on you. I want to talk to you all briefly about Civilization 7, which has had a troubled launch.

Some of you may follow me closely enough to know I’m a hardcore Civ fan. I’m a wannabe gamer. I love gaming. I could get really into gaming. But I don’t have the time. My preference is for games that are very deep and immersive and require hours of time for a single gaming experience. My life actually only enables me to basically do the opposite: a quick game on my phone that kills five or 10 minutes.

Civ is my guilty pleasure. I’ve played every major iteration of it since the first. And I was SUPER excited for the release of Civilization 7 earlier this year. The company that owns the rights, Firaxis, did a really interesting pre-release marketing job. They built a lot of buzz.

The game itself, which I obviously preordered and played on the day it released, was disappointing. It looked good, but it was very shallow. Every Civ iteration grapples with the challenge of needing to improve on/enhance the game experience compared to earlier releases, but also with the problem of complexity. If you just keep layering on new functions, you eventually make the game unplayable. So there’s a natural tension there. But 7 was still weirdly sparse. There were very basic user interface issues. Fonts were very small, colour choices led to a lot of struggle making out details. It all looked beautiful at a distance until you were actually trying to absorb any information, info necessary to effectively play the game, at a glance. It was impossible. Also, and this is a separate but related problem, some very basic functions and information necessary for gameplay simply wasn’t explained. You kind of had to intuit things.

There were big, structural changes to the gameplay as well. How the game works is very different from earlier iterations. These changes were very controversial — seemingly hated, to be honest. I didn’t actually hate them. I didn’t always love them, but I was pretty open minded to them and kind of liked some of the new mechanics.

But. Ahem. The game itself regressed in some key ways, compared to its predecessor, Civ 6. A small example: religious warfare. For non-players, in Civilization, you can control units for your empire and you move them around the map. Military units can fight other military units, and can seize and defend territory. Religious units were a totally different game mechanic that players would use to export their religion, and to prevent their own cities from being converted. It added a really fun and elegant layer to the game, and one that could be meaningful enough to swing outcomes in a big way.

Civ 7 just nerfed that. Religion is useless. Worse, it’s annoying.

The company has been very aggressive at rolling out updates to fix some of these issues. They’ve also been very open in communicating what they’re working on to the audience. I admire that. I really do. But the numbers don’t lie. Civ 7 is, today, drawing maybe 15-20% of the audience that Civ 6 did. (Using Steam Charts for those figures.) I don’t know if this is a flop for Firaxis, but it has to be a disappointment verging on a disaster.

They’re rolling out a lot of updates and new content to try and fix these issues. And I think they’re making strides. But, like, yikes. Every time they announce a new update, I’m shocked by how much of that stuff should have just been in the game in the first place.

I’m not a gaming expert, like I said. I wish. I’m also not an expert in gaming as a business. I’m just a guy who loves playing Civ. I’ve stuck with 7 since it was released and I’ve given every major update a fair chance. I’ve had fun playing the game. But I just can’t deny that 6 was much better, more playable, and more fun. And I don’t know how much more time the developer has before even hardcore fans like me just give up and go back to 6 permanently.

Anyway. This is what happens when all the news is due to come out later in a day.

Thank you for your attention to this matter!

Matt is more patient with Firaxis than I am, I have to admit. I downloaded and played Civilization VII on release day … played a few rounds of a couple of different civilization/leader combos … played one up to the new “change your entire civilization to a totally different one in a new age” mechanic, saved and quit the game. I’m sure I’ll play again at some point, but VII didn’t grab my attention and interest the way all the earlier iterations had done and I hate hate hate the swapping civilizations gimmick with a passion because it ruins my immersion in the civilization I’m trying to build. But I’m pretty far from being the target market for this game, so take my dissatisfaction with a shaker of salt.

A Modern Stocked Pistol: B&T’s Universal Service Weapon (USW)

Filed under: Europe, Weapons — Tags: , , , , , — Nicholas @ 02:00

Forgotten Weapons
Published 9 Jun 2025

The genesis of the B&T USW was a two and a half hour car ride home from a youth hockey game, when Karl Brugger and a friend were thinking about how to improve police effectiveness with handguns. What would make a handgun more accurate in practice? Clearly a red for and a shoulder stock. So how does one add those elements to a pistol while maintaining easy carry in a service holster? The answer was the USW.

The first prototypes were built on AT-84 Sphinx pistols (a Swiss-made copy of the CZ75). The first production run used Sphinx components, but with newly made frames and slide that incorporated cocking surfaces forward on the slide and an extension off the frame to mount the side-folding stock and Aimpoint Nano optic. Only a few of these were made, as the project was never all that popular.

Other experiments included conversions for other pistol models, with the SIG P320 being the most practical. Clamp-on conversion kits were made for guns like the CZ P10, Walther PPQ, and Glock.

Perhaps the most influential outcome of the project was the optic. Aimpoint originally developed the Nano as B&T’s request, but in the original form is was not nearly as reliable as Aimpoint desired. It was iterated and ruggedized (and renamed to avoid a lawsuit over the Beretta Nano pistol) and became the very successful Aimpoint Acro.

A39 Tortoise: The Forgotten Super Heavy

Filed under: Britain, History, Military, Weapons, WW2 — Tags: , , , — Nicholas @ 02:00

The Tank Museum
Published 13 Jun 2025

The A39 Tortoise. The last complete survivor of a World War Two project that arrived just a little too late. Some have called it “The British Jagdtiger” – but is that actually a fair comparison?

Tortoise was a part of the strategy the Allies would need to defeat Germany during the Second World War. It was recognised that total victory could only occur on German soil – and that meant smashing through the imposing defences of the Siegfried Line. The Allies would need a Heavy Assault tank. Many designs were put forward for this role, including the Valiant, the A33 and the T14 Assault tank.

The A39 is extremely well-armoured. Its casemate construction could withstand a hit from an 88mm gun at close ranges. But at 78-tons, this lumbering beast was both slow and heavy – and is one of the largest and heaviest vehicles in the museum’s collection. In terms of firepower, the impressive 32pdr gun was extremely effective against both concrete and enemy armour. It even has room inside for 7 crew!

In the end, the Tortoise arrived too late to see any action on the battlefield. It was intended to form a part of the 79th Armoured Division – making it one of Hobart’s Funnies. Whether Tortoise would have become the stuff of legend, or a bit of a joke – well, we’ll leave that question up to you.

H&K MG4: Germany’s New 5.56mm Squad Machine Gun

Filed under: Germany, History, Military, Weapons — Tags: , , , — Nicholas @ 02:00

Forgotten Weapons
Published 7 Jun 2025

Heckler & Koch released the MG4, a new 5.56mm squad machine gun in 2001. It was adopted by the German army in 2005, and then by the Spanish and Portuguese armies in 2007. Alongside its sister weapon the 7.62mm MG5, it is H&K’s current export machine gun.

The MG4 fires from an open bolt, with a 2-lug rotating bolt locking system and a long stroke gas piston operating system. It uses standard M27 NATO links for feeding, and does not have a semiauto selector setting. Mechanically, the MG4 uses a front trunnion into which both the barrel and bolt lock independently — meaning that the quick-change barrel can be removed with the bolt in either the forward or rearward position.

As one would expect for a 5.56mm machine gun weighing 18 pounds, it is very easy to control.

Haenel’s Prototype Simplified Sturmgewehr StG45(H)

Filed under: Germany, History, Military, Weapons, WW2 — Tags: , , , — Nicholas @ 02:00

Forgotten Weapons
Published 26 May 2025

In December 1944, the Haenel company received permission to produce a simplified version of the StG-44 Sturmgewehr. The idea was to keep the mechanical system and controls as similar as possible to the design in use, but simplify the design to reduce the cost and time of production. The design was never completed, and this is the only known surviving prototype. It was most likely captured by American forces when they occupied the Haenel factory in April 1945, although that is not documented. It is a pretty impressive adaptation of the StG design; far simpler to manufacture than the original design. Would it have worked? We don’t know for sure as there are no known German or American test reports, but it certainly seems viable to me.

C93 Borchardt: the First Successful Self-Loading Pistol

Filed under: Germany, History, Military, Weapons — Tags: , , , , — Nicholas @ 02:00

Forgotten Weapons
Published 29 Nov 2015

Hugo Borchardt was a brilliant and well-traveled firearms designer. He was born in Germany but emigrated to the United States at a fairly young age, where he became engaged in the gun trade. He spent time working with Winchester, Remington (where he patented improvements on James Paris Lee’s box magazine idea), and Sharps (where he designed the M1878 rifle and worked as Superintendent). With this experience under his belt, he returned to Germany and worked with the Loewe/DWM corporation.

Borchardt’s seminal invention in Germany was his C93 automatic pistol, which was the first of its kinds using a reasonably powerful cartridge and a locked-breech action. Unlike the other designs extant at the time, the C93 went into commercial production, and 3000 were ultimately made. The gun was safe and reliable, and it set the standard for locating a detachable box magazine in the grip, which remains the standard today. However, its very bulky mainspring assembly led to it being a rather awkward handgun to use (although it was a quite nice carbine when used with its detachable shoulder stock).

Borchardt’s talents came hand-in-hand with a fair amount of hubris, and he refused to consider the possibility that his pistol could be improved. Several military trials requested a smaller and handier version of the gun, and when Borchardt refused to make those changes, DWM gave the job to a man named Georg Luger. Luger was very good at taking existing designs and improving them, and he transformed the basic action of the C93 into the Luger automatic pistol, which of course became one of the most iconic handguns ever made.

Stamm-Saurer Model 1913 Long-Recoil Prototype Rifle

Filed under: Europe, History, Military, Weapons — Tags: , , , — Nicholas @ 02:00

Forgotten Weapons
Published 21 May 2025

Hans Stamm developed a series of firearms in Switzerland in the early 1900s, and today we are looking at a second-pattern Model 1913 semiauto rifle. This was developed while Stamm was working for the Saurer company, where he headed its small arms division. Stamm’s Model 1907 straight pull rifle failed to win military adoption, and so in 1910 he began working on a quite complex long recoil system. The first prototype was finished in 1912, and by 1913 another seven examples were made.

These are sent to the Swiss and Belgian militaries for consideration, but neither are interested — and the outbreak of World War One ends possibilities for other adoption.

Beretta Model 1934: Italy’s Unassuming Workhorse Service Pistol

Filed under: History, Italy, Military, USA, WW2 — Tags: , , , — Nicholas @ 02:00

Forgotten Weapons
Published 16 May 2025

The Beretta Model 34 was basically the final iteration of a design by Tullio Marengoni that began all the way back in 1915. That pistol was updated in the early 1920s, and that one was updated in 1931. The Model 1931 was converted to .380 ACP (aka 9mm Short) as the Model 1932, which became the Model 1934 with the addition of a hammer half-cock notch and steel grip panel backing. Police and military contracts began in 1935, with the Italian Army formally adopting it in 1936 and purchasing nearly 400,000 of them by 1940. It would ultimately see service with basically all the armed elements of the Italian military and civil security services as well as foreign nations including Germany, Romania, and Finland. As a souvenir for British or American troops, the Model 1934 was also a prized piece.

Essentially, the Model 1934 is compact, simple, durable, and reliable. It is an excellent military pistol; easy to carry unobtrusively but dependable when called upon. After World War Two it stayed in production until 1980, despite introduction of many other more modern options by Beretta. Fenian Needham Conversion: Just the Thing for Invading Canada

Filed under: Britain, Cancon, History, Military, USA, Weapons — Tags: , , , , — Nicholas @ 02:00

Forgotten Weapons
Published 10 May 2025

The Fenian Brotherhood was formed in the US in 1858, a partner organization to the Irish Republican Brotherhood. The groups were militant organizations looking to procure Irish independence from the British, and they found significant support among the Irish-American immigrant community. In November 1865 they purchased some 7500 1861- and 1863-pattern muskets left over from Civil War production, and used them to invade Canada in April 1866. The idea was to capture the country and then trade it to the British in exchange for Irish independence … but the invasion went quite badly. The Fenians briefly held Fort Erie, but were pushed out after a few hours and largely arrested by American forces.

The Fenians’ muskets were confiscated, but all returned by the end of 1866 in exchange for promised Irish-American support of embattled President Johnson. By 1868, the group was making plans for another attempt at conquering Canada. This time they would have better arms — they obtained a disused locomotive factory in Trenton NJ and set up the Pioneer Arms Works to convert 5,020 muskets into centerfire Needham Conversion breechloaders. These were given chambers that could fire standard .58 centerfire ammunition, or the .577 Snider ammunition that the Fenians expected to be able to procure once in Canada. Most of the guns also had their stocks cut, to allow them to be packed in shorter crates for transit. These usually have a distinctive “V” cut in the stock, which was spliced back together before use.

When the second invasion came in April 1870, it was again a failure. Only 800-1000 men turned out of the 5,000+ expected. They were scattered among several different muster points on the border, and the Canadians were once again aware of their plans. The most substantial fight was at a place called Eccles Hill, where the Missisiquoi Home Guard was ready and waiting for them with good Ballard rifles. Upon crossing the border, the Fenians were soundly defeated.

This second time, the guns were confiscated and not returned. Instead, the Watervliet Arsenal sold them as surplus in 1871. They were purchased by Schuyler, Hartley & Graham for commercial resale, and thanks to that several hundred remain in collector hands today.

Jennings 5-Shot Repeating Flintlock Pistol

Filed under: History, USA, Weapons — Tags: , , , , , — Nicholas @ 02:00

Forgotten Weapons
Published 9 May 2025

Isaiah Jennings patented an improvement to the Belton repeating flintlock system in 1821 — but we don’t know exactly what his idea was because the Patent Office lost his patent (and many others) in a large 1836 fire. Jennings’ system was used by several gunsmiths, though. In 1828/9 the State of New York contracted to convert 521 of their muskets to Jennings’-pattern repeaters. We also have a few examples like this custom five-shot pistol made by John Caswell of upstate New York.

Jennings’ system uses superposed charges loaded in the barrel along with a movable lock. Each charge has its own touch hole, and the cover plates for them act as stops for movement of the lock, to ensure proper alignment. The trigger will fire the lock in any position, and it is also fitted with an automatic magazine frizzen — so cocking the hammer automatically charges priming powder into the pan and closes the frizzen. These were very advanced arms for the early 1800s, and expensive to produce.

Unique British Crankfire .58 Morse Manual Machine Gun

Filed under: Britain, History, Military, USA — Tags: , , , , , — Nicholas @ 02:00

Forgotten Weapons
Published 30 Apr 2025

This is a really interesting piece with a mostly unknown origin. It was manufactured in the UK (the barrel was deemed Enfield-made by former Royal Armouries curator Herb Woodend) and is chambered for the .58 Morse centerfire cartridge. The date of production is unknown. It uses a gravity-feed magazine and fires via hand crank. Turning the crank cycles the bolt forward and back, not completely unlike a Maxim gun but without the automatic operation. It came out of a small Canadian museum in the 1950s, but its provenance before that is unknown.

QotD: The development of the “halftrack” during the interwar period

Filed under: Britain, France, History, Military, Quotations, Weapons, WW2 — Tags: , , , , — Nicholas @ 01:00

The period between WWI and WWII – the “interwar” period – was a period of broad experimentation with tank design and so by the time we get to WWII there are a number of sub-groupings of tanks. Tanks could be defined by weight or by function. The main issue in both cases was the essential tradeoff between speed, firepower and armor: the heavier you made the armor and the gun the heavier and thus slower the tank was. The British thus divided their tank designs between “cruiser tanks” which were faster but lighter and intended to replace cavalry while the “infantry tanks” were intended to do the role that WWI tanks largely had in supporting infantry advances. Other armies divided their tanks between “light”, “medium”, and “heavy” tanks (along with the often designed but rarely deployed “super heavy” tanks).

What drove the differences in tank development between countries were differences between how each of those countries imagined using their tanks, that is differences in tank doctrine. Now we should be clear here that there were some fundamental commonalities between the major schools of tank thinking: in just about all cases tanks were supposed to support infantry in the offensive by providing armor and direct fire support, including knocking out enemy tanks. Where doctrine differed is exactly how that would be accomplished: France’s doctrine of “Methodical Battle” generally envisaged tanks moving at the speed of mostly foot infantry and being distributed fairly evenly throughout primarily infantry formations. That led to tanks that were fairly slow with limited range but heavily armored, often with just a one-man turret (which was a terrible idea, but the doctrine reasoned you wouldn’t need more in a slow-moving combat environment). Of course this worked poorly in the event.

More successful maneuver warfare doctrines recognized that the tank needed infantry to perform its intended function (it has to have infantry to support) but that tanks could now move fast enough and coordinate well enough (with radios) that any supporting arms like infantry or artillery needed to move a lot faster than walking speed to keep up. Both German “maneuver warfare” (Bewegungskrieg) and Soviet “Deep Operations” (or “Deep Battle”) doctrine saw the value in concentrating their tanks into powerful striking formations that could punch hard and move fast. But tanks alone are very vulnerable and in any event to attack effectively they need things like artillery support or anti-air protection. So it was necessary to find ways to allow those arms to keep up with the tanks (and indeed, a “Panzer divsion” is not only or even mostly made up of tanks!).

At the most basic level, one could simply put the infantry on trucks or other converted unarmored civilian vehicles, making “motorized” infantry, but […] part of the design of tanks is to allow them to go places that conventional civilian vehicles designed for roads cannot and in any event an unarmored truck is a large, vulnerable tempting target on the battlefield.

The result is the steady emergence of what are sometimes jokingly called “battle taxis” – specialized armored vehicles designed to allow the infantry to keep up with the tanks so that they can continue to be mutually supporting, while being more off-road capable and less vulnerable than a truck. In WWII, these sorts of vehicles were often “half-tracks” – semi-armored, open-topped vehicles with tires on the front wheels and tracks for the back wheels, though the British “Universal Carrier” was fully tracked. Crucially, while these half-tracks might mount a heavy machine gun for defense, providing fire support was not their job; being open-topped made them particularly vulnerable to air-bursting shells and while they were less vulnerable to fire than a truck, they weren’t invulnerable by any means. The intended use was to deposit infantry at the edge of the combat area, which they’d then move through on foot, not to drive straight through the fight.

The particular vulnerability of the open-top design led to the emergence of fully-enclosed armored personnel carriers almost immediately after WWII in the form of vehicles like the M75 Armored Infantry Vehicle (though the later M113 APC was eventually to be far more common) and the Soviet BTRs (“Bronetransporter” or “armored transport”), beginning with the BTR-40; Soviet BTRs tended to be wheeled whereas American APCs tend to be tracked, something that also goes for their IFVs (discussed below). These vehicles often look to a journalist or the lay observer like a tank, but they do not function like tanks. The M113 APC, for instance, has just about 1.7 inches of aluminum-alloy armor, compared to the almost four inches of much heavier steel armor on the contemporary M60 “Patton” tank. So while these vehicles are armored, they are not intended to stick in the fight and are vulnerable to much lighter munitions than contemporary tank would be.

At the same time, it wasn’t just the infantry that needed to be able to keep up: these powerful striking units (German Panzer divisions, Soviet mechanized corps or US armored divisions, etc.) needed to be able to also bring their heavy weaponry with them. At the start of WWII, artillery, anti-tank guns and anti-air artillery remained almost entirely “towed” artillery – that is, it was pulled into position by a truck (or frequently in this period still by horses) and emplaced (“unlimbered”) to be fired. Such systems couldn’t really keep up with the tanks they needed to support and so we see those weapons also get mechanized into self-propelled artillery and anti-air (and for some armies, tank destroyers, although the tank eventually usurps this role entirely).

Self-propelled platforms proved to have another advantage that became a lot more important over time: they could fire and then immediately reposition. Whereas a conventional howitzer has to be towed into position, unlimbered, set up, loaded, fired, then limbered again before it can move, something like the M7 Priest can drive itself into position, fire almost immediately and then immediately move. This maneuver, called “shoot-and-scoot” (or, more boringly, “fire-and-displace”) enables artillery to avoid counter-battery fire (when an army tries to shut down enemy artillery by returning fire with its own artillery). As artillery got more accurate and especially with the advent of anti-artillery radars, being able to shoot-and-scoot became essential.

Now while self-propelled platforms were tracked (indeed, often using the same chassis as the tanks they supported), they’re not tanks. They’re designed primarily for indirect fire (there is, of course, a sidebar to be written here on German “assault guns” – Sturmgeschütz – and their awkward place in this typology, but let’s keep it simple), that is firing at a high arc from long range where the shell practically falls on the target and thus are expected to be operating well behind the lines. Consequently, their armor is generally much thinner because they’re not designed to be tanks, but to play the same role that towed artillery (or anti-air, or rocket artillery, etc.) would have, only with more mobility.

So by the end of WWII, we have both tanks of various weight-classes, along with a number of tank-like objects (APCs, self-propelled artillery and anti-air) which are not tanks but are instead meant to allow their various arms to keep up with the tanks as part of a combined arms package.

Bret Devereaux, “Collections: When is a ‘Tank’ Not a Tank?”, A Collection of Unmitigated Pedantry, 2022-05-06.
